exports/widgets library

Widgets exports for prf_design

Classes

AnimatedStatCard
ImagePreviewPage
A full-screen image preview page with pan and zoom support.
PDFViewerPage
PRFActionCard
PRFAppBar
PRFBottomSheet
PRFBrandedNavBar
PRFCarouselItem
A media item for the carousel.
PRFCategoryChips<T>
A generic, reusable category chip selector widget.
PRFChatView<T>
PRFCircularProgressIndicator
PRFConfirmationDialog
PRFDestroyButton
PRFDetailActionCard
PRFDomainTabSection
PRFEmailInput
PRFEmptyView
PRFErrorView
A widget that displays an error state with an optional retry action.
PRFFormFieldLabel
PRFFormSection
PRFGoogleAuthButton
PRFInfoCard
PRFLinearProgressIndicator
PRFMediaCarousel
Full-screen media carousel with swipe navigation, zoom, and action buttons.
PRFMediaGrid
A masonry (Pinterest-style) grid for displaying media tiles.
PRFMediaTile
A single media tile for use inside a media grid.
PRFMessageBubble
PRFNameInput
PRFNavBar
PRFNavigationTile
PRFNumberInput
PRFPasswordInput
PRFPhoneInput
PRFPrimaryButton
PRFReplyComposer
PRFSearchableList<T>
PRFSearchableListEntry<T>
PRFSecondaryButton
PRFSectionHeader
PRFSnackbar
Unified snackbar helper with typed variants (error, success, info, warning).
PRFStatusBadge
PRFTextAreaInput
PRFTextInput
PRFTimelineDateBadge
A timeline date badge with an optional connector line.
ReplyStatusView
A widget for selecting reply status (read/unread).
StatHighlightCard
WrappedPageIndicator